    釩酸釔(YVO4)

     


    釩酸釔(YVO4)單晶是一種具有優(yōu)良物理光學(xué)性能的雙折射晶體材料。該晶體透光范圍寬,透過(guò)率高、雙折射系數(shù)大、并易于加工。因此,YVO4晶體被廣泛應(yīng)用于光纖通信領(lǐng)域,是光通信無(wú)源器件如光隔離器、旋光器、延遲器、偏振器中的關(guān)鍵材料。

    Properties:
     

    Transmitting range
    400~5000nm
    Crystal Symmetry
    Zircon tetragonal, space group D4h
    Crystal Cell
    a=b=7.12 °, c=6.29 °
    Density
    4.22 g/cm2
    Hygroscopic Susceptibility
    Non-hygroscopic
    Mohs Hardness
    5 glass like
    Thermal Optical Coefficient
    Δna /dT=8.5x10-6 /K; dnc /dT=3.0x10-6 /K
    Thermal Conductivity Coefficient
    ||C: 5.23 w/m/k; ⊥C:5.10w/m/k
    Crystal Class
    Positive uniaxial with no=na=nb, ne=nc
    Refractive Indices,
    no=1.9929, ne=2.2154, △n=0.2225, ρ=6.04°, at 630nm
    Birefringence(△n=ne-no)
    no=1.9500, ne=2.1554, △n=0.2054, ρ=5.72°, at 1300nm
    and Walk-Off Angle at 45 deg(ρ)
    no=1.9447, ne=2.1486, Dn=0.2039, ρ=5.69°, at 1550nm
    Sellmeier Equation ( l in μm)
    no2 =3.77834+0.069736/( λ2 -0.04724)-0.0108133 λ2
    ne2 =4.5905+0.110534/( λ2 -0.04813)-0.0122676 λ2
